Cross-Platform GUI Toolkits (Again)?

Futurepower(R) queries: "It has been 2 1/2 years since the previous Ask Slashdot about GUI Toolkits. There were many helpful comments then, such as this one. Since then, Slashdot has discussed wxWindows vs. MFC and considered the book, Creating Applications with Mozilla. The best comparison table is apparently still the GUI Toolkit, Framework Page. Which is the best cross-platform GUI toolkit that provides native look and feel? Which is the best overall? What IDEs and other tools do you use? What are the problems?" Slashdot also had a match-up between GTK+ and Qt, but some of you might have missed that one. How have recent changes in this ballpark changed your feelings on the issue?

  2. QT convert by RiBread · · Score: 5, Interesting
    I developed apps with Delphi for 4 years and was completely sold that Borland had the best solution around.

    At my new employment I had a project that needed to be cross platform. I was itching to use Kylix, however it wasn't due to be finished for another 8 months. Looking into the details I saw that they built the corss platform support on QT.

    After checking out the QT tutorials I was immediatly hooked. QT is intuitive; I can't think of many other APIs I would grace with this description. In addition to being well thought out it has a superb implementation. I've been using it happily for 2 years.

    The only thing I miss is the strong third party component community that Delphi/Kylix has. I'm a huge fan of "buy don't build". You can really put quality touches on your app by finding the right component someone else has already made.

  3. The best cross platform GUI toolkit I've used is.. by Admiral+Akbar · · Score: 5, Interesting

    available with Eiffel Software's EiffelStudio development suite. It's called Vision2 and provides platform independent look and feel by using a bridge pattern to separate an interface layer from the underlying implementation layer (which uses the Win32 API and Gtk+ for the platform dependent stuff).

  4. A few glitches in the Linux version... by aquarian · · Score: 5, Interesting

    Eclipse does have a few glitches in the Linux version.

    For those that don't know, Eclipse is based on a unique IBM GUI toolkit called SWT. It has a Java API, but the underlying code is native. The supposed advantage of this is that it can be used by any Java programmer as an alternative to Swing, but it's faster. The problem is that it's only available for Windows and Linux, and since the underlying code is native, it has to be separately developed and maintained. Since more GUI apps are run on Windows, there's more pressure to make the Windows code work right, and the Linux code is always a little behind.

    I don't think there's any advantage to SWT these days, with Swing programming coming along so well. For anyone who doubts this, have a look at IntelliJ Idea, a really nice Java IDE that's Swing-based, and super fast. Frankly, I think Eclipse and SWT was a move to establish an IBM-centric Java community, with lots of vendor lock-in. Hijacking Java from Sun, if you will.

    Eclipse *is* a really nice application, but I don't think IBM's motives in creating it were at all community-minded. And I don't have high regard, or high hopes, for SWT.

  5. nonsense by RelliK · · Score: 4, Interesting
    Tcl is a complete hack of a language. Imagine a Bourne shell, but with a totally ugly syntax. It is completely unsuitable for any sort of large application (and I have had an exteme misfortune of writing a farily large project in Tcl/Tk). What's wrong with Tcl? Let's see...
    • It's a scripting language, interpreted on the fly. That means only the parts of the code that are actually being executed are parsed. You may have a syntax error in another part of the code, but you will not notice it unless you run that code. Even Perl parses the entire file before running it, but Tcl, just like shell, essentially treats the file as a stream of commands.
    • It's weakly typed. This is actually the bane of all scripting languages that makes them unsuitable for large projects. You can assign an integer / float / string / file handle / whatever to the same variable without the interpreter even twitching.
    • Here is a biggie: it does not force explicit declaration of variables.A variable simply comes to life when it's first used. Good luck trying to debug misspelled variable names.

    And these are just my biggest objectsions. The Tk widget set is not bad. It is quite ugly and limited, but good enough for a small GUI app. The underlying language though is absolute crap.

    The only good thing about Tcl is that it provides a (relatively) easy way of interfacing with C code: you can expose C functions as Tcl commands (e.g. you could map Tcl command foobar to C function MyFooBar()). This is, in fact, what Tool Control Language was designed for: exposing C functions to a high-level script to facilitate easy automated testing. However, trying to write a real application in Tcl is an excercise in futility. There are much better alternatives available. But, if all you have is a hammer, everyting looks like a nail -- that is why Tcl is the "past and future king".
